Why You'll want to Undertake a Rabbit

So, you have decided to receive a rabbit. You've completed all of your exploration. You've got rabbit-proofed your home. You've got a cage, foods, and plenty of toys. You have even decided on a name. But Possibly An important final decision is still to come back: the place would you get your rabbit?

Several pet merchants give rabbits available for sale. On observing a crate jam packed with adorably helpless infant bunnies, many folks are unable to resist the urge to acquire one house appropriate there and afterwards. Pet suppliers depend on the enchantment of your immature rabbit to stimulate impulse purchasing. Frequently, the rabbit is acquired as a Kid's pet by an Grownup who isn't going to realize that rabbits make inadequate pets for modest little ones. There aren't any trustworthy figures concerning how many of these rabbits are deserted, specified up to shelters, or die from improper care, but It appears possible that many endure this kind of destiny. A person animal rescue Corporation experiences that in 2007, they been given requests for sheltering for 380 rabbits- though in the same calendar year, they put only two rabbits in new houses. Many people think of rabbits to be a form of rodent, and on par using a rat or gerbil with regards to care and motivation necessary. This misconception has awful effects for the unfortunate rabbit. With an average lifespan of all-around ten years, the baby rabbit you got for your child when he was eight must still be alive when he is getting ready to graduate from highschool.

This is just one of the numerous reasons that adopting a rabbit from an animal shelter is preferable to buying one from a pet store or breeder. Most rabbits marketed in pet stores are a lot less than a year outdated, and when the store will not be specifically scrupulous, They could even be younger than 6 months- the minimal age at which a rabbit is usually faraway from its mom. Rabbits present in animal shelters operate the gamut of ages, from a couple months to old age. By picking a rabbit whose age aligns with the length of motivation you are ready to make, you will conserve on your own and also the rabbit a substantial amount of hardship. Also, experienced rabbits tend to be greater decisions for initial-time rabbit proprietors. Their behavioral designs became extra predictable, and they have presently passed by way of their "rebellious teenager" period of time. Shelter volunteers are way more likely to be knowledgeable about the exclusive personalities of the individual rabbits they provide than a pet keep personnel. This could go a great distance towards averting catastrophe down the line, when that bunny that was so adorable and interesting like a kit gets to be an unholy terror in maturity.

Also, adoption is a far more economical possibility than obtaining a rabbit. You help save the cost of the rabbit by itself- usually in between $20-fifty. A great deal more appreciably, on the other hand, you preserve the cost of spaying/neutering the animal. This really is an basically non-optional procedure for most of us keen on possessing a rabbit as being a pet. Rabbits which have not been mounted will likely be a lot more intense and temperamental, will commonly spray objects with its scent glands, and are more prone to varied health issues, such as uterine cancer. Prices for that method range tremendously from just one veterinarian to another, but it will eventually Price not less than $one hundred. Rabbits adopted from shelters are almost always set beforehand, And so the adoption payment (usually about $30) can be a terrific deal.

Finally, adopting a rabbit is often a humane and ethical strategy to own a pet with no contributing to cruelty and neglect. Although a lot of rabbit breeders do maintain substantial benchmarks of treatment, many Other folks work as "rabbit mills" exactly where most rabbits direct small, brutal existences. Pet stores typically continue to keep rabbits in substandard circumstances, with minor expertise in the needs in the animal, and from time to time euthanize the animal once they attain maturity. Presented the considerable excessive of rabbits held in shelters, there is no cause to assist industries that lead to the issues of rabbit overpopulation and neglect. By adopting a rabbit, you don't just help you save that animal from euthanization, but also evade taking part inside a morally dubious market.

In case you are thinking about obtaining a rabbit from the retail outlet or breeder just because you have listened to that a presented breed is "the ideal breed for pet rabbits", you might want to reconsider. Even though breeders and homeowners do report some quite standard developments inside the conduct of certain breeds, rabbits are much as well individualistic in their personalities for these traits to generally be trusted. Any breed can develop a first-price pet, or a total basket circumstance. If you would like make sure that the rabbit you happen to be acquiring will make a good pet, Chatting with a well-informed shelter worker about a selected rabbit is often a far better bet. When all of these variables are regarded as, there is hardly any purpose never to adopt a rabbit. Doing this will preserve you cash, worry and uncertainty, and most importantly of all, the lifetime of a rabbit.
